Position

The company is seeking an experienced Cloud DevSecOps Engineer to embed security into cloud delivery pipelines and operational workflows. This role focuses on enabling secure, automated, and scalable cloud deployments within a shared responsibility model. The successful candidate will develop and maintain secure CI/CD pipelines, integrate security controls, and support cloud automation initiatives. This position plays a key role in ensuring that security and operational excellence are integral to our cloud transformation efforts, contributing to reliable and compliant cloud environments that support our business objectives.

Overall Responsibilities:

  • Design, build, and continuously improve secure CI/CD pipelines integrated with security controls such as code scanning, secrets management, and infrastructure scanning.
  • Automate cloud infrastructure provisioning and deployment using Infrastructure as Code (IaC).
  • Embed security practices like vulnerability scanning, secrets management, and compliance validation into delivery workflows.
  • Establish and promote standardized deployment patterns to improve reliability and operational risk mitigation.
  • Monitor pipeline and platform security, troubleshoot issues, and implement continuous improvement processes.

Experience Requirements:

  • 5 to 6 years of hands-on experience in cloud engineering and DevOps/SecOps roles.
  • Proven expertise in building and managing secure automation pipelines in cloud environments, especially Azure.
  • Experience integrating security controls such as code scans, IaC scans, secrets management, and compliance checks into automated workflows.

Qualifications:

  •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, or related field; equivalent professional experience acceptable.
  • Certifications such as Certified DevSecOps Engineer, Azure Security Engineer Associate, or equivalents are preferred.

Language Requirements:

  • Proficiency in English is expected; additional language skills may be advantageous.
